Job Closed

This listing is no longer active.

General Electric - GE logo
General Electric - GE

Built on more than 130 years of experience, GE Vernova, a division of General Electric (GE), is leading a new era of energy by electrifying the world while work

Software Architecture & Development Lead

Location

United States

Posted

175 days ago

Salary

0

Seniority

Senior

Job Description

Software Architecture & Development Lead

General Electric - GE

• Define software architecture and development standards for automation tools supporting Grid Automation engineering and delivery teams. • Lead development of automation platforms and scripting solutions (Python, Rust, C#, Node.js, etc.) to reduce cycle time and eliminate repetitive tasks. • Integrate engineering tools with corporate systems (Smartsheet, Jira, SAP, GitHub, DOORS, relay configuration tools). • Design and deploy scalable APIs and microservices for critical workflows such as: relay settings validation file parsing and data extraction automated reporting and documentation. • Establish CI/CD pipelines, secure coding practices, automated testing, and reliable DevOps processes. • Architect data models and storage solutions for engineering artifacts, test evidence, and project traceability. • Promote modular design, component reuse, and creation of shared internal libraries. • Lead code reviews, mentor developers, and build technical capabilities within engineering teams. • Collaborate with AI/LLM teams to integrate intelligent automation into engineering digital assistants and copilots. • Ensure high performance, maintainability, scalability, and utility-grade cybersecurity compliance across all developed software.

Job Requirements

  • Bachelor’s or Master’s degree in Software Engineering, Computer Science, Electrical Engineering, or related technical field.
  • Professional experience in software development and architecture.
  • Experience leading end-to-end software delivery in technical or industrial environments.
  • Demonstrated success in automating engineering or industrial workflows strongly preferred.
  • Proficiency in multiple programming languages (Python mandatory; Rust, C#, Node.js highly desirable).
  • Experience with microservices architecture and API design.
  • Working knowledge of CI/CD tools (GitHub Actions, Jenkins, Azure DevOps, etc.).
  • Experience with secure DevOps practices and cybersecurity controls.
  • Familiarity with data modeling, relational and non-relational databases.
  • Experience integrating systems via REST/GraphQL APIs and enterprise connectors.
  • Understanding of SCADA, Protection & Control, and IEC 61850 workflows is a strong advantage.
  • Fluent English and Portuguese required.
  • Spanish proficiency preferred.

Benefits

  • Relocation Assistance Provided: No

Related Job Pages

More Full-stack Engineer Jobs

MTC Solutions logo

Junior Product Engineer

MTC Solutions

The Mass Timber Hardware Experts

Full TimeRemoteTeam 11-50Since 2011H1B No Sponsor

• Assist in creating and updating design guides, white papers, and engineering resources. • Interpret test results and research findings under the guidance of senior engineers to produce design parameters and engineering tables. • Apply relevant design standards (CSA O86, NDS, Eurocode 5, AS/NZS) and document appropriate assumptions and limits. • Work with the R&D team to incorporate data, the Marketing team to refine visual layout and UX/UI, and the Technical Service team to address recurring industry questions. • Support the development and maintenance of calculation spreadsheets and digital engineering tools (e.g., CADwork plugins or software tools). • Identify gaps or ambiguities in existing resources and propose updates that simplify the designer experience.

Canada
$70K - $90K / year
PaySupp logo

Software Engineer

PaySupp

Online B2B Fintech

Full TimeRemoteTeam 1-10Since 2021H1B No Sponsor

• Design, develop and install software solutions. • Build high-quality, innovative and fully performing software in compliance with coding standards and technical design. • Execute full life-cycle software development • Write well designed, testable, efficient code • Produce specifications and determining operational feasibility • Integrate software components into fully functional software systems • Develop software verification plans and quality assurance procedures • Document and maintain software functionality • Tailor and deploy software tools, processes and metrics • Serve as a subject matter expert • Comply with project plans and industry standards

Egypt
OtherRemoteTeam 51-200Since 2015H1B No Sponsor

• Join a people-first company to build meaningful products and lasting partnerships. • Work collaboratively to achieve meaningful long-term outcomes. • Contribute to the development of complex user interfaces and scalable applications.

United States
Job Closed
decircle logo

Product Engineer, Data Product Lead

decircle

Talent Partner for decentralized organizations and projects that are building Web3.

Full TimeRemoteTeam 1-10Since 2019H1B No Sponsor

• Own and execute data-driven product development from problem definition to delivery • Design, build, and maintain Risk Dashboards for protocol and ecosystem monitoring • Develop Ecosystem Health Analytics, including KPIs, alerts, and trend analysis • Work hands-on with on-chain data (indexing, querying, transformation, and analysis) • Collaborate in a lean execution model, prioritizing speed, clarity, and impact • Manage product execution and workflow using Linear.app • Partner with governance, risk, and engineering stakeholders to align metrics with decision-making

United Kingdom
Job Closed